Other Adoption Financing Options

Home Mortgage Refinance

One of the many ways to generate income to afford the cost of a private adoption is mortgage refinancing. The decision to refinance has just as much to do with your circumstances as it does with the current interest rate available. For example, if you have an adjustable-rate mortgage , or your fixed-rate mortgage is about to turn into an ARM, and the interest rate is going up, you might want to consider refinancing or renegotiating your mortgage rate. Other factors, such as the amount of equity you have gained and whether or not you pay mortgage insurance, help determine whether you are a good candidate for refinancing.

Refinancing can help by reducing your monthly mortgage payment, and the surplus could then go into savings toward your adoption costs. It can also help if you are able to use your home equity and higher appraisal of your homes value to refinance for an amount higher than your current mortgage, using the excess amount to help with your adoption costs.

Home Equity Line of Credit

Though perhaps not the first approach to generating funds toward the cost of a domestic adoption, seeking a Home Equity Line of Credit has become a common way to pay adoption costs. This involves using a credit line to borrow against the equity in your home.

When choosing this method to generate the funds needed, keep in mind that you must pay this money back. You can use your full tax refund from using the Adoption Tax Credit.

Three Types Of Adoption

According to the Child Welfare Information Gateway, there are three ways to bring an adopted child home: public agency adoption, which generally works to place foster children into forever homes, private adoption, and inter-country adoption. Each of these adoption methods have their own particular costs, although there are some costs you can expect to pay no matter what route you take to adoption. Those universal adoption costs include home study expenses and legal fees.

Cost of a domestic adoption

According to the Child Welfare Information Gateway from the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services, the average costs of adopting a child in the United States is between $20,000 and $45,000. This price can cover legal fees, home studies, travel and lodging, court fees, and medical and living expenses for the birth parent. Soronen said its important to get clarity from the adoption agency or the attorney involved on specific costs prior to making a commitment.

Parents can expect a private adoption agency to be more expensive. However, some agencies will offer a sliding scale based on the adoptive parents income.

Adoption costs by state may differ since adoption laws vary state to state.

How Much Does It Cost To Adopt A Child In International Adoption

International adoptions tend to be the priciest, as well as the most unpredictable, of all adoptions. Because each country has its own fee schedule and requirements, working with an agency is essential. Your agency should be able to give you a fee schedule near the beginning of your relationship with them. So, how much does it cost to adopt a child via international adoption? In general, you should expect to spend around $10,000 to $40,000 by the time the process reaches completion.

The largest part of the cost for international adoption is the adoption agencys program fee. This will cover the agency fees, government fees, and paperwork. Agency fees go towards the costs of arranging the adoptionfrom passports for the child to translation costs and legal fees in that country.Every country has different requirements and fees. For instance, some countries require an additional orphanage fee in addition to the country fee. In China, for example, this generally runs between $3,000 and $4,000.

Another set of fees to remember are those associated with post-placement visits. Once your child is home, there are just a few more simple visits that are needed so your adoption can be completed. These three final visits will be completed by your agencys social workers. They just want to make sure that your family is adjusting and the newly-adopted childs well-being is still being cared for. The cost for these visits can range from $700 to $1,400.

Home Study Conducted By The Department Of Family And Protective Services

The Department of Family and Protective Services will conduct a home study of your residence to verify the information provided to them in your application for adoption and by your references.

All household members will be interviewed by DFPS staff, and all aspects of your home will be studied and inspected. You will be viewed in your home environment at least once.
